Job Duties
- assist in the preparation of hot and/or cold foods
- serve and deliver food to residents as required
- maintain cleanliness of dining areas as assigned
- properly store food utilizing knowledge of temperature requirements and spoilage
- transport/deliver food/beverage items to assigned residents
- assist lead porter or other staff in lifting or transporting large utilities within the kitchen area
- load/operate dishwasher machine
- ensure proper temperature, chemical supplies, and clean water levels are maintained for proper sanitation
